Abstract: A display device having a frame period including reset, compensation, relay, emission, and initialization periods. Each pixel includes: an organic light emitting diode having an anode coupled to a second node and a electrode coupled to a second power source; a first transistor between a first power source and the second node, and a gate electrode coupled to a first node; a second transistor between the first node and the second node; a third transistor between the first power source and a third node; a fourth transistor between a fourth node and the third node; a fifth transistor between a data line and the fourth node; a sixth transistor between a third power source and the second node; a first capacitor between the third node and the first node; and a second capacitor coupled the fourth node and the third power source.

Abstract: A sub-pixel includes a light emitting element, a first transistor that applies a driving current to the light emitting element, a second transistor that writes a data voltage in response to a write gate signal, a first capacitor electrically connected to a control electrode of the first transistor, a second capacitor including a first electrode electrically connected to the second transistor and a second electrode electrically connected to the control electrode of the first transistor, a third transistor that diode-connects the first transistor in response to a compensation gate signal, a fourth transistor that applies a first initialization voltage to a first electrode of the third transistor in response to an initialization gate signal, and a fifth transistor that transfers the driving current to the light emitting element in response to an emission signal.

Abstract: A pixel includes a first transistor including a first electrode electrically connected to a first power line, a second electrode, and a gate electrode connected to a first node, a light emitting element including a first electrode, and a second electrode electrically connected to a second power line, a second transistor connected between a data line and a second node, and including a gate electrode electrically connected to a first scan line, a third transistor connected between the second node and the first electrode of the light emitting element, and including a gate electrode electrically connected to a second scan line, a first capacitor connected between the first power line and the first node, and a second capacitor connected between the first node and the second node.

Abstract: A display device comprises a first voltage line disposed in a first metal layer on a substrate providing a high-level voltage, a vertical voltage line disposed on a side of the first voltage line providing a low-level voltage, a first transistor disposed in an active layer on the first metal layer and including a drain electrode, an active region, a source electrode, and a gate electrode, a first anode connection electrode disposed in a third metal layer on the second metal layer and electrically connected to the source electrode of the first transistor, a first electrode and a second electrode that are disposed in a fourth metal layer on the third metal layer, and a plurality of light-emitting element areas including a plurality of light-emitting elements aligned between the first and second electrodes and spaced apart from the first voltage line and the vertical voltage line in a plan view.

Abstract: A display device includes a display panel including a display area having a scan area, and having a power area on one side of the scan area, and a non-display area surrounding the display area, and having a pad portion on one side of the non-display area, the pad portion including a first pad including line pads connected to lines of the scan area, a second pad including line pads, and a power pad configured to supply an off signal to a line of the lines of the power area and connected to lines of the power area, and a panel-lighting-test line on at least one side of the power pad, and spaced apart from the power pad.

Abstract: A transistor array panel according to an exemplary embodiment includes a substrate, and a first transistor and a second transistor positioned on the substrate. Each of the first transistor and the second transistor includes: a first electrode; a second electrode overlapping the first electrode; a spacing member positioned between the first electrode and the second electrode; a semiconductor layer extending along a side wall of the spacing member; and a gate electrode overlapping the semiconductor layer. A thickness of the spacing member of the first transistor is larger than a thickness of the spacing member of the second transistor.
